Look at the Panasonic and Toshiba RPTVs, they look nice.

Panasonic PT-53X54
Toshiba 51H84

They actually have better color rendition and are brighter than the LCD sets but they suffer from burn in.  Not as bad as you think though.

CRTs will be around until digital displays can produce nice inky blacks.  CRTs are also the only displays which can resolve 1080p under $8k at the moment.  You want digital at that res you gotta drop $25k. :\\  Intel\'s hyped up inexpensive LCOS chips are all but vaporware at this point.

CRTs you absolutely have to get an ISF tech to do it up in order for it to look good.  COnvergence has to be screwed with every year or so.

I will have a CRT in my home theater though unless I fall into a pit of money and I can afford to get a DLP projector.



Oh yeah, another bad thing about CRTs..

BURN IN!!!!!

Good luck playing video games.

Hope you enjoy stretching 4x3 material.
